Definitions
adj.形容词 adjective
- 1
- : somewhat poor; rather poor.
Examples
About nightfall,—their horse having made poorish fight, though the foot had stood to it like men,—they roll universally away.
Without more or less of this knowledge, a lady, even the wife of a peer, is but a poorish thing.
Never mind your being poorish as yet; there's money in your head-piece as there's money i' the sown field, but it must ha' time.
It was, in fact, a poorish match and the young couple were dependent more or less on Wardle.
Dartie reflected that Bosinney would have a poorish time in that cab if he didn't look sharp!
